Is there a difference between drywall and sheetrock for fire resistance?

Sheetrock is a brand name for drywall. However, not all Sheetrock products are designed for enhanced fire resistance. True fire-rated drywall, often called Type X or Type C, contains specific additives to improve its fire performance. It's crucial to specify the correct type for safety in Mississippi.

What are the benefits of fire-resistant drywall in Mississippi?

Fire-resistant drywall provides a critical barrier that slows the spread of flames and smoke, offering valuable extra time for evacuation and potentially limiting property damage.
